Transponder Keys

Automobile manufacturers have adopted the technology of transponder keys as an additional layer of protection against theft. These chips are contained within the head of the plastic on your key, and transmit a signal once it is inserted into the ignition. The car's receiver matches this signal with a serial code that is programmed into its immobiliser system. The car will begin to move if the match is successful. Transponder keys provide greater security than standard car keys. They require specialist equipment to duplicate or replace them.

Modern Volkswagens are equipped with key fobs that lock and unlock the vehicle as well as open the trunk and even start the engine. Key fobs like these are more expensive than traditional ones, but provide greater security and comfort. If you've lost your Volkswagen key fob, you'll usually get a replacement from an area hardware store or auto locksmith. It's important to remember that you might need to reprogram the key fob to match your vehicle's security system.

The cost of replacing the cost of replacing a Volkswagen key is dependent on the type and where it is purchased. Keys made of metal are usually the least, whereas more sophisticated options like transponder chips keys and Smart Keys with remote locking systems can cost more.
